The National Bingo Game Association launches National Cash
For those of you unfamiliar with the name, the National Bingo Game Association works with leading bingo operators to offer games of bingo with massive prizes. They deal with land based bingo halls and basically use the total number of tickets sold, across all clubs, to generate a total prize fund. This happens twice a day, every day of the week for 364 days of the year, which is a mammoth undertaking.
The National Bingo Game has been operating now since 1986 and the majority of regional and national bingo chains take place, including well known names such as Mecca Bingo, Buckingham Bingo and Beacon Bingo. The prize varies according to the day and time; from Sunday to Friday afternoons for example the prize can reach up to £5000, whereas on a Saturday afternoon it can reach £10,000. If you strike it lucky in an evening session then you’ll be even more pleased – as Monday to Thursday evenings the prize is up to £20,000, increasing to £25,000 Friday to Sunday. The idea behind the game is very straight forward, to be a winner you have to call house on the least number of calls throughout all participating halls.
It is said that the introduction of the National Game back in 1986 gave a fresh burst of life to bingo, and it will be interesting to see how their latest move, the launch of their new linked game, National Cash, performs. Bingo hall players, for just a £1 stake, will be able to play for a £5000 jackpot, twice a day, every day. To win the jackpot players have to call house in 45 numbers or less. However, if no-one crosses off all of their numbers within the 45 maximum, the game will continue until one player in each of the halls linked to National House calls house to claim a prize.
National Cash has the honour to be the first wide area mechanised cash bingo game in the UK. Previously, before the installation of this new technology, less than 30 bingo halls could link up, whereas now up to 250 UK bingo halls are said to be looking to participate.
Bingo halls have faced a tough time of things lately, but this is another move that could lead to a comeback and rise in popularity.
